Job Description

An enthusiastic and wellinformed Business Teacher is needed at an Outstanding Girls school in Harrow to inspire students in Key Stages 4 and 5 with the world of business.

Responsibilities

  • Create and deliver engaging Business Teacher lessons to Key Stages 4 and 5.
  • Prepare students for examinations in Business Studies.
  • Develop students understanding of business operations.

Requirements

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) with a Business Studies specialism.
  • Experience teaching Business Studies at secondary level including ALevel.
  • Strong understanding of business theory and current trends.

Benefits

  • Outer London Payscale.
  • Collaborative Business Studies department.
  • Opportunities for professional development.

About the SchoolThis highachieving Outstanding Girls school in Harrow is committed to providing a stimulating and supportive learning environment where students can excel academically and develop strong leadership skills. The school has a strong sense of community and a focus on empowering young women.
